Vedic Astrology, also known as Jyotish Shastra, is an ancient science that investigates celestial motions and their implications for human existence. Planets, also known as Grahas, play an important part in forming a person's destiny by affecting many elements of life, including work, relationships, health, and spirituality. Understanding the importance of each planet is necessary for making accurate astrological forecasts.
The Nine Planets (Navagrahas) in Vedic Astrology
Vedic astrology recognises nine basic planets, each with its own set of qualities and effects. The planets are:
Planet (Graha) | Sanskrit Name | Governing Aspects | Natural Significations |
Sun | Surya | Soul, Ego, Authority | Vitality, Father, Government |
Moon | Chandra | Mind, Emotions, Intuition | Mother, Emotions, Mental Health |
Mars | Mangal | Energy, Courage, War | Aggression, Strength, Siblings |
Mercury | Budh | Intelligence, Communication | Business, Speech, Logic |
Jupiter | Guru | Wisdom, Wealth, Expansion | Knowledge, Spirituality, Teachers |
Venus | Shukra | Love, Beauty, Luxury | Relationships, Arts, Comforts |
Saturn | Shani | Discipline, Karma, Longevity | Hardships, Responsibility, Justice |
Rahu | Rahu | Ambition, Obsession, Materialism | Innovation, Illusion, Sudden Changes |
Ketu | Ketu | Detachment, Spirituality | Mysticism, Moksha, Karmic Release |
Detailed Impact of Each Planet
Sun (Surya): The King of the Solar System
Represents authority, willpower, and the soul.
Manages leadership, self-esteem, and health.
Rules for Leo (Simha Rashi).
A powerful Sun provides a person with strength and success, but a weak Sun might produce ego issues and a lack of confidence.
Moon (Chandra): The Mind and Emotions
Controls emotions, intuition, and mental stability.
Cancer is ruled by Karka Rashi.
A strong Moon promotes tranquilly, creativity, and flexibility, while a weak Moon causes worry and emotional instability.
Mars (Mangal): The Warrior Planet
Rules Aries (Mesha Rashi) and Scorpio (Vrishchika Rashi).
A robust Mars gives confidence, resolve, and physical power, but an afflicted Mars may cause anger difficulties and impulsiveness.
Mercury (Budh): The planet of intelligence.
Governs communication, intelligence, and analytical abilities.
Rules Gemini (Mithuna Rashi) and Virgo (Kanya Rashi).
A powerful Mercury gives a person incisive wit, smart business knowledge, and eloquence. A low Mercury level causes disorientation and speech difficulties.
Jupiter (Guru): The Planet of Wisdom
It represents wisdom, spirituality, and growth.
Rules Sagittarius (Dhanu Rashi) and Pisces (Meena Rashi).
A well-placed Jupiter gives knowledge, riches, and good fortune, but an afflicted Jupiter causes excesses and a lack of focus.
Venus (Shukra): The Planet of Love and Luxury.
Rules Taurus (Vrishabha Rashi) and Libra (Tula Rashi).
It represents beauty, romance, the arts, and comfort.
A strong Venus brings satisfaction in love, success in artistic professions, and monetary pleasures, but a weak Venus may lead to relationship issues and indulgence.
Saturn (Shani): The Karmic Taskmaster
Rules Capricorn (Makara Rashi) and Aquarius (Kumbha Rashi).
Gooverns discipline, duty, and karmic justice.
A properly positioned Saturn rewards hard effort, patience, and spiritual progress, while a weak or afflicted Saturn causes delays, hardships, and hurdles.
Rahu: The Shadow Planet of Desires.
Symbolises consumerism, ambition, and rapid change.
Has no rulership, but is considered powerful in Gemini and Virgo.
A well-placed Rahu brings success in unorthodox domains, invention, and renown, but an afflicted Rahu causes obsession, dishonesty, and instability.
Ketu: The Planet of Detachment.
Has no rulership but is considered powerful in Sagittarius and Pisces.
It symbolises spirituality, detachment, and past-life karma.
A well-placed Ketu promotes spiritual enlightenment, psychic talents, and emancipation, while an afflicted Ketu creates bewilderment, lack of concentration, and solitude.
Planetary Strength and Influence
Planets' effect varies according on their position, dignity, and aspects in a birth chart (Kundali). The primary elements impacting a planet's effect are:
House placement - The house in which the planet is positioned influences its consequences.
Exaltation and Debilitation - Some planets are powerful in some signs while weak in others.
Aspects and Conjunctions - Interactions with other planets change their impact.
Dasha eras - Planetary eras (Mahadasha, Antardasha) exert their influence on life.
Planetary Exaltation & Debilitation Signs
Planet | Exalted in (Strongest) | Debilitated in (Weakest) |
Sun | Aries | Libra |
Moon | Taurus | Scorpio |
Mars | Capricorn | Cancer |
Mercury | Virgo | Pisces |
Jupiter | Cancer | Capricorn |
Venus | Pisces | Virgo |
Saturn | Libra | Aries |
Rahu | Taurus & Gemini | Scorpio & Sagittarius |
Ketu | Scorpio & Sagittarius | Taurus & Gemini |
In Vedic astrology, planets are cosmic forces that influence fate. Their placements, aspects, and conjunctions have an impact on many facets of life, including personality, professional achievement, and relationships. Understanding planetary placements in a birth chart (Kundli) may help people understand their strengths and limitations, helping them to make educated choices and stay on track with their karmic path.
